SPORTING NEWS.

[REUTER'S TELEGRAMS.] By Electric Telegraph—Copyright. THE SCULLING CHAMPIONSHIP OF THE WORLD. HANLAN'S CHALLENGE TO BEACH. (Received September 16, 0.55 a.m.) Sydney, September 15. A meeting was held this evening for the purpose of arranging a second match between Beach and Hanlati, but without success, as Beach had already made arrangements to row a match with Clifford for the championship of the world. The meeting is postponed for a week in order to get Clifford's sanction to cancel the match between himself and Beach, and enable the latter to make further arrangements with Hanlan.
